NH Homeowner Relieved of Rising Flood Insurance Costs

A homeowner in Bedford, NH, had been struggling with rising flood insurance premiums nearing the point of doubling their mortgage payments. Seeking relief from this financial burden, they contacted their insurance agent, who recognized the need for specialized assistance and recommended NFE as a trusted partner.

We began by conducting a complimentary engineering review of the property, which involved a comprehensive assessment of the A-zone property to determine potential eligibility for a Letter of Map Amendment (LOMA) or other cost-saving solutions. Following a thorough review, NFE qualified the property for a LOMA.

Throughout the process, NFE worked closely with the insurance agent and the homeowner, providing valuable guidance and support, handling every step of the FEMA submission process, including FEMA's Requests for Information (RFI), and ensuring smooth application progress.

NFE's efforts yielded excellent results for the homeowner - who obtained a LOMA for their property, successfully removing the lender mandate for flood insurance. The solution provided relief from high insurance costs and improved the property's overall worth and marketability should the owner decide to sell in the future, offering peace of mind and allowing the homeowner to focus on other financial goals.
